T C I set for Wellwood test
Ron Burke does not often enter horses in the William Wellwood Memorial for 2-year-old trotters, but the trainer has enjoyed success in his limited trips to the event, winning in 2014 with Habitat and 2015 with Southwind Frank. On Saturday, Burke will have a horse in the Wellwood for only the second time in seven years when T C I meets seven foes in the third of three C$30,000 eliminations at Woodbine Mohawk Park.
